    "Triple layered with cheese, tortillas, and chicken, this chicken enchilada casserole is quick and easy to make for busy weeknights. A flavorful chicken enchilada casserole with corn tortillas, enchilada sauce, shredded chicken, and lots of melty cheese layered together in one delicious dish. Making chicken enchilada casserole is somewhat similar to making lasagna in the way that you’re layering ingredients into a pan. It’s a fun twist on regular enchiladas and is great for feeding larger groups. Once you’ve layered it all together, pop it in the oven and bake until bubbly, hot, and the cheese is melty. So easy! "

    Serves8

    Preparation Time20 min

    Cooking Time45 min

    Cooking MethodCasserole

    Cooking Vessel Size13X9 Baking Dish

    Ingredients

    • 29 1/5 ounces Enchilada sauce
    • 18 Corn Tortillas
    • 2 cups Cooked Chicken Breast
    • 8 ounces Cheddar Cheese
    • 8 ounces Monterey Jack Cheese
    • Cilantro, Olives, Tomatoes, Avocado, Sour Cream
